Has anyone experienced changes io their body odour?

Mark1 profile image
7 Replies

I have never had a strong natural scent (honestly!). However, even with a much reduced sense of smell, I noticed a change to my body odour in the year or so post diagnosis. Then, when I started sinemet, my body odour returned to normal! One of the more trivial changes with PD, but i should be interested to know if anyone has had a similar experience.

Another possibility is that there is a change in the way your olfactory system PERCEIVES odors, including your own. While my sense of smell was failing, many things smelled different, (worse), than before.
